Subject: Broker cut-over complete

Team,

Cut-over from Quillmast 2.9 to Harborline 4.1 finished last night. Downtime: 11 minutes. All producers re-authenticated; the legacy plaintext listener is disabled. Dead-letter queues were drained and replayed before the switch. Two consumers in the Tarnfield cluster needed manual restarts; both confirmed healthy. TLS is now mandatory on every interface and the old shared credential has been revoked. For your security review, the effective broker settings now running in production are listed below.

deployment values, faduf-tawep:
SORDOR_LOG_LEVEL=error
SORDOR_METRICS_HOST=metrics.sordor.nelvrolabs.internal
SORDOR_POOL_SIZE=4

## Build Provenance: Sproutly Scheduler

Sproutly's watering scheduler is built reproducibly from the tagged source tree; plugin authors should compile against the published interface bundle, not internal modules. Each release artifact carries a signed provenance record listing compiler version, dependency digests, and the schedule-engine revision. Match your plugin's target against that record before distribution. The current release's build token appears below.

build token for fajof-yahof: htk4_869f

### Account Recovery — Catalogue Import (Lintwood)

Quick one for review: when the Lintwood catalogue import wipes a patron's session table, the recovery flow re-seeds accounts from the nightly snapshot. Check that the importer skips locked accounts — last time it didn't. To rerun recovery against staging you'll need the vault passphrase, which is appended just below.

recovery phrase for yafof-tajof: julmir-kelax-julvan-holath-belvan-holir-ralael-ralvan-ralath-julvan-silmir-istmir-kaswyn-ulamir